 Key Stages in Your Education Journey

Secondary education is full of important milestones where young people make choices that shape their future:

  • Year 9 Options – This is the first big step. Students choose the subjects they’ll study for GCSEs, balancing interests, strengths, and future aspirations. It’s a chance to explore passions while keeping doors open for later opportunities.
  • Post-16 Choices – After GCSEs, students decide whether to continue in sixth form, attend college, start an apprenticeship, or pursue other training. This stage is about building specialist knowledge and skills that prepare them for higher education or the workplace.
  • Post-18 Pathways – At this point, young people can move on to university, higher apprenticeships, or enter full-time employment. It’s the stage where career ambitions start to take shape and long-term goals come into focus.

Each stage is an exciting opportunity to plan ahead, explore options, and take steps toward a rewarding future.

Supporting Decisions at Every Stage

Students and parents have access to a range of online platforms designed to guide them through key educational choices. At Teign, learners are introduced to these platforms and given the chance to explore them in different settings — with tutors in school, at home alongside parents, and with the support of our dedicated Careers Advisor.
